Case 1: Stranded Energy Capture (Nations with Hydro/Geothermal Surplus)
Nations with abundant renewable energy sources (such as hydro in Scandinavia or geothermal in Iceland/Central America) often face periods of surplus energy that cannot be exported. Instead of curtailing production, these nations are now deploying high-performance computing facilities to convert that surplus into digital value protocols. This effectively tokenizes their excess energy, creating a dynamic reserve asset and a powerful economic engine.
